Dennis Smith is the founder of First Responders Financial LLC and is a licensed financial advisor with the NASD and the SEC. In his 18 years as a New York City firefighter, he developed profound respect for the professionalism of the firefighters, police officers, EMTs, and nurses with whom he worked in the more than 40 alarms his engine company responded to every day. He witnessed their willingness to give of themselves in the course of their duty. He also came to know their financial needs, which were his own needs – how to raise a family with small but growing resources, how to save for the children's educations and for family vacations, and how to budget for the essentials of a modern life…. like telephone service, a reliable car, insurance for auto, home, and supplemental health. And also, when the children go to school, to realize how burdensome are the costs of their computers and electronic accessories, and if they need a car, both the car and its insurance, not to mention the gasoline that will take them from home to school – costs that require savings. And, finally, how important it is to consider the safest and most productive way to supplement the pension systems that exist within the emergency professions, for in today's world, hardly a pension system exists that is adequate to the costs of retirement.
Early in 2001, Dennis, who had spent half of his life in the emergency service, and the other half writing books and creating businesses, realized that there were financial companies serving the exclusive interests of teachers and also military professionals. He asked the natural question: Why was there no company designed to serve only the financial interests of our first responders – who, including spouses, are nine and a half million strong in the United States. The answer was simple: If it did not exist, it should be created. So, Dennis set about making First Responders Financial Services LLC a company that exists only to serve the interests of first responders - and not be, as all of us have come to know, one of the many companies with wider interests seeking to include first responders beneath their tent of customers.
